Im new to thunderbird. Even though I have created a main password I find that I suddenly I can open the application and view accounts and even security info, without putting it in anyway. I press cancel and the application opens and I can see accounts.
I havent saved the password anywhere so its not automatically being filled in. Is this just for offline access? How can I tell if my accounts are secured and what my offline/ online status is when using thunderbird?

I suppose you're talking about the Primary Password. The Primary Password protects the account password(s) of the email accounts you set up in Thunderbird. It does not protect the contents of the Thunderbird profile. Also see https://support.mozilla.org/kb/protect-your-thunderbird-passwords-primary-password
